Frequently Asked Questions about Boca Raton
How much are Studio apartments in Boca Raton?
There are currently 174 Studio Apartments in Boca Raton with rent ranges from $1,400 to $4,835 with an average price of $1,931.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Boca Raton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Boca Raton ranges from $650 to $5,916 with an average monthly rent of $2,389.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Boca Raton c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Boca Raton range from $1,300 to $9,396.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,061.
How expensive are Boca Raton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 171 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Boca Raton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,200 to $7,500 - averaging $3,644 for the location.
